Thanksgiving day, annual national holiday in the united states and canada celebrating the harvest and other blessings of the past year. Learn about the history of thanksgiving, facts about the mayflower and the pilgrims, and more. Families and friends get together for a meal, which traditionally includes a roast turkey, stuffing, potatoes, vegetables,. Thanksgiving day is a time to celebrate gratitude, family, and tradition. Every year, on the fourth thursday of november, americans gather for a huge feast to give thanks. It wasn’t until 1863, in the midst of the civil war, that president abraham lincoln proclaimed a national thanksgiving day to be held on the last thursday in november. It is observed on the fourth thursday in november. Thanksgiving day 2026 is on thursday, november 26, a time for americans to give thanks for the harvest and spend time with family and friends.
